15206 ZIP Code — Pittsburgh, PA

Allegheny County, Pennsylvania

ZIP code 15206 is located in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ania, within Allegheny County. It covers approximately 4.76 square miles and serves a population of 29,316 residents. This is a standard ZIP code in the Eastern (ET) timezone, served by area code 412.

About ZIP code 15206

The housing stock consists of a significant share of large multi-unit buildings. Most homes were built in the pre-1940, giving the area an established character. Median home value is $281,500. Renters make up the majority at 59%, typical of denser urban areas.

The gap between median ($64,978) and mean household income suggests income inequality — a small number of higher earners pull the average up.

The dominant occupation class is management, business, and professional, with education and healthcare as the leading industry. The average commute of 25 minutes is near the national average. Remote work is prevalent — 22% of workers work from home.

Educational attainment is high — 58% of residents hold a bachelor's degree or higher, well above the national average of 33%.

Overall, ZIP code 15206 reflects a community defined by a highly educated population and a high rate of remote workers.
